The hexadecimal color code #8CDFDD corresponds to the code RGB( 140, 223, 221 ). It's a shade of Green. This color is a combination of red (at 0,55 level), green (at 0,87 level) and blue (at 0,87 level). Its brightness is 71% and its saturation is 56%. It is composed of red at 23%, green at 38% and blue at 37%.
